The Batman 2's Start Window Seeming Revealed In New Report


We're still waiting on an official announcement regarding the status of Matt Reeves' The Batman Part II, but a UK production site has now confirmed that cameras are scheduled to begin rolling next summer.



After the critical and commercial success of The Batman in March 2022, a sequel was first announced the following month, though filming faced several delays as writer-director Matt Reeves carefully refined the script, which was finally finished in June 2025, with its release set for October 2027.


Now, according to a new report from Variety on Warner Bros. Discovery's sale to Netflix vs. Paramount, The Batman Part II is expected to start filming "by the end of May." Additionally, Superman: Man of Tomorrow (a sequel to 2025's Superman) is set to start filming "in a few weeks," which is scheduled for release on July 9, 2027.


According to the report, James Gunn and Peter Safran's positions as co-heads of DC Studios appear to be stable amidst the sale with both sequels set to start filming soon, since replacing them at this stage would likely cause significant disruption.

Directed once again by Matt Reeves, who co-wrote the script with Mattson Tomlin, The Batman Part II is expected to focus more on the Bruce Wayne alter ego, more than past Batman movies, as he tackles a new investigation that uncovers deeper corruption and growing unrest in Gotham City after the events of The Penguin.


Other than Robert Pattinson as Bruce Wayne, The Batman Part II's cast also reportedly includes the return of Jeffrey Wright as Jim Gordon, Andy Serkis as Alfred Pennyworth, Colin Farrell as the Penguin, and Barry Keoghan as the Joker. New additions reportedly include Sebastian Stan as Harvey Dent and Scarlett Johansson in an undisclosed role.


With The Batman Part II finally set to start production by the end of May, it should have no problem being ready in time for its scheduled release date on October 1, 2027.
